where it spawns

Nothing summons it. It joins the Dungeon population the moment Plantera dies, and it is one of the rarer things in there, so you meet it by accident far more often than on purpose. Where it appears is not even across the Dungeon either: stretches backed by the tiled wall types produce it far more often than the brick corridors, so a farm built anywhere else will feel broken when it is only working as intended. A Lifeform Analyzer will announce one before it has line of sight on you, which is the whole point of carrying one down here.

why it hits so hard

It walks slowly and looks harmless until it sees you. Then it stops dead and puts a spread of four rounds into you, and a full spread landing at once is not something most builds at this point simply walk off. The dangerous moment is rounding a corner into one, because the first volley comes out much faster than the ones that follow. After that opening shot the rhythm is slow and easy to read.

shutting it down

Two mechanics hand you the fight. Every hit you land pushes its next volley back, so any weapon with a real rate of fire holds it in a loop where it never gets to shoot at all. It also cannot fire while it is in the air, so it is harmless the whole time it is jumping down a shaft at you.

Between those two, closing in is safer than backing off, which is the opposite of what the enemy looks like it wants. It also only shoots when it can actually see you, so a single block of cover between you and it buys as much time as you need to reposition.

trivia

  • The SWAT Helmet it leaves behind and its flavor text both point at it having been part of some elite unit before it was bones.
  • The gun on its sprite looks like a SPAS-12, a weapon that appears nowhere in the game, and it matches neither of the guns it can drop.
